Handle
If your patio door handle lock is damaged, it can be repaired. The locks are usually made of mortise and have hook latches that are spring loaded. As time passes, they become susceptible to breaking and stretching. It is possible to replace the entire lock fitting or just the handle. Upgrade to a central rail lock. It is more secure and may qualify you for discounts on home insurance. A patio door security bar can be used to entrap behind the door to stop it from sliding.

Cylinder
Having a secure lock on your patio door will make it harder for burglars to gain entry to your home. Cylinder locks require a key to open, unlike handle locks that can be opened by the help of a handle. Cylinder locks may be more expensive, but they provide better security for your home. If you're considering installing a cylinder lock on your bi-fold doors, talk to a professional locksmith who can provide you with the best option for your needs.
A mortice lock is another popular option. These locks are typically found on old uPVC windows and doors. They are a good option for older homes because they are strong and provide the security that isn't available on more modern doors. These locks are prone to rusting and can be difficult or to fix. If your mortise lock has broken it is essential to replace it as soon as you can.
